A Lyons Township High School English teacher and his brother lent their talents Nov. 23 for a pre-Thanksgiving concert in LaGrange Park to raise $5,000 for the Kelli O’Laughlin Memorial Fund.
Faculty member Frank Alletto and his brother, John, had planned an informal concert on Thanksgiving eve at the Mattone Restaurant, 31st Street and La Grange Road, as Janks, an acoustic duo playing popular cover selections.
As LT alumni, the brothers were among those saddened by the murder of freshman Kelli O’Laughlin, who was killed Oct. 27 when she encountered a burglar after school in her Indian Head Park home.
The two musicians decided to make their performance a benefit for the memorial fund to provide scholarships and other educational efforts, said Frank Alleto’s wife, Erica Alletto. About 250 community members attended.
“We started contacting area businesses for a raffle, and we got 46 donations, including items signed by players from the Cubs, Sox and Bears,” Erica Alletto said.
“We heard from Kelli’s third-grade teacher at the Highlands Elementary School, and she collected a lot of donations as well,” Erica Alletto said.
“There aren’t words to express how everybody is feeling about the tragedy,” she said. “But at least this brings to light something to keep her memory alive and the memorial fund for educational purposes.”
